Welcome to the Carlisle and Hampton Hill Federation. We are delighted that you have taken the time to find out more about us.

The Federation, which began in September 2014, comprises of two schools - Carlisle Infant School and Hampton Hill Junior School. The Federation has given us a wonderful opportunity to bring these two excellent schools closer together with each and every child at the heart of all that we do.

As a Federation, we have one governing body representing both schools. We have a Headteacher and Deputy Headteacher at each school, and a Business Manager who works across both schools.

Carlisle Infant School

We are a large over-subscribed 3 form entry infant school with 270 pupils on roll.

We are fortunate to be situated close to Bushy Park and our pupils benefit from regular visits to this wonderful outdoor environment. We believe that children learn best when they can be active and we have a large outdoor environment including two designated gardens so the children have daily opportunities to develop their skills in a range of subjects out of doors.

We are a school where children are encouraged to develop their creative talents and we are proud of or ARTSmark Gold award which we have held since 2005. We are committed to curriculum enrichment and have a large number of creative workshops and visiting artists who come in to school and provide a focus for the children’s learning.

 

Hampton Hill Junior School

We are a large and over-subscribed three form entry junior school with 360 pupils on roll. We federated with Carlisle Infant School in September 2014 and work extremely well with them, sharing high aspirations and a consistency in approach which supports and promotes the clear progression of all pupils, as they move through KS1 and KS2. We also have very positive working relationships with other partner KS1 and KS3 schools and are committed to ensuring a successful transition for all pupils.

Teaching School Alliance

Who are we?

Richmond Primary Teaching School Alliance was accredited in the summer of 2014 following an application led by Hampton Hill Junior School. We are an alliance of primary schools from across the Borough of Richmond who work together with other key education providers to achieve the national goals for a school led system in education with the aim of improving standards of education for children in Richmond and beyond.
